Church of the Forty Martyrs

The stone 18th century Church of the Forty Martyrs stands where the river Trubezh flows into the huge Plescheevo lake. It was constructed on the money of Moscow merchants Ivan and Maxim Schelyagins in 1755 on the site of two dilapidated wooden churches.
